Last French hostage Lazarevic freed in Mali | Last French hostage Lazarevic freed in Mali |
(about 17 hours later) | |
The last French hostage to be held by Islamist militants has been freed after three years, French President Francois Hollande has announced. | The last French hostage to be held by Islamist militants has been freed after three years, French President Francois Hollande has announced. |
Serge Lazarevic was snatched in Mali in November 2011 along with fellow Frenchman Philippe Verdon. | Serge Lazarevic was snatched in Mali in November 2011 along with fellow Frenchman Philippe Verdon. |
Militants from the Al-Qaeda in the Islamic Maghreb (AQIM) group killed Mr Verdon last year. | |
TV footage showed Mr Lazarevic smiling as he told reporters that he had lost about 20kg (44lb) during his ordeal. | |
"I would like to thank the people of Niger who have collaborated with France to get me freed," he said, adding that he felt "fine". | |
Mr Hollande said there were no more French hostages waiting to be freed anywhere in the world. | |
He said that Mr Lazarevic was in "relatively good health" despite the conditions of his captivity. | |
The former hostage is now in Niger from where he will return to France. | |
AQIM kidnapped a number of Western hostages before the French military deployed its forces against the group in January 2013. | AQIM kidnapped a number of Western hostages before the French military deployed its forces against the group in January 2013. |
There were at one point at least 14 French nationals being held by Islamists in West Africa. | There were at one point at least 14 French nationals being held by Islamists in West Africa. |
Mr Hollande also thanked the authorities in Niger and Mali, who had "worked towards this happy outcome". | |
There have been no details about how the release of Mr Lazarevic was secured. Anonymous sources told the Reuters news agency that several Islamist-linked militants held in Mali were freed. | |
The French government has repeatedly denied paying ransoms for hostages. | The French government has repeatedly denied paying ransoms for hostages. |
During his captivity, Mr Lazarevic appeared in several AQIM videos. Mr Verdon was killed last year, with the militants saying it was in retaliation for France's intervention in Mali. | |
There was concern for the 50-year-old father's health in November after he was filmed pleading for his release. | There was concern for the 50-year-old father's health in November after he was filmed pleading for his release. |
He looked frail in the video and was filmed alongside a second hostage, Dutchman Sjaak Rijke. | He looked frail in the video and was filmed alongside a second hostage, Dutchman Sjaak Rijke. |
It is not clear where the two men were held or whether they were held together. | It is not clear where the two men were held or whether they were held together. |
Mr Rijke was kidnapped in November 2011, while visiting the city of Timbuktu as a tourist. There has been no news from him since the video. | Mr Rijke was kidnapped in November 2011, while visiting the city of Timbuktu as a tourist. There has been no news from him since the video. |
